Transaction 327e258349413f5ba8bdb29ecf8d52d7ce89ac18cfaa6bd72c85693322dd178d
1 Input
1 Output
-
327e258349413f5ba8bdb29ecf8d52d7ce89ac18cfaa6bd72c85693322dd178d:0
- value
- 21398174
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03bc39d1bf0df1d82a681bc7c2799d31009b4b64 OP_EQUAL
- address
- 322mSHFh5cGGW6uVBoNCXw5fUWiT18H7aC